First, there's the crime scene investigation. This involves a team of forensic experts who meticulously document the scene. They take photos, collect physical evidence like shell casings, and look for any clues that can shed light on the events. This team can spend hours, if not days, examining every detail, as even the smallest piece of evidence can be crucial. This phase is critical to building a case, and the information gathered helps reconstruct what happened, from the location of the shooters to the trajectory of the bullets.
Then, there’s witness interviews. Locating and talking to anyone who might have seen something or have relevant information is essential. This can be challenging because people might be hesitant to come forward, either from fear or a lack of trust in the system. Law enforcement will often work hard to encourage witnesses to speak and provide them with support to ensure their safety and build trust. Witnesses can provide valuable insights into the events, providing details on what happened, the people involved, and any potential motives.
Another key aspect is evidence analysis. All the physical evidence collected, such as weapons, bullet fragments, and DNA samples, is sent to a lab for analysis. Forensic scientists will run tests to link the evidence to specific individuals, weapons, or locations. The lab results can confirm or refute statements made by witnesses or suspects, which is super important in building a solid case. This process is complex and often takes time, but it’s crucial for ensuring that the legal process is based on sound scientific evidence.
Surveillance footage is also an important piece of the puzzle. If there are cameras in the area, authorities will review the footage to see if they can capture any of the events. This evidence is particularly valuable, as it can give investigators a clear picture of what happened, who was involved, and how the shooting unfolded. This footage may also uncover evidence that would be otherwise overlooked.
Finally, investigators consider motives and suspects. They gather as much information as possible to determine why the shooting happened. They look into the backgrounds of potential suspects, their relationships with victims, and any possible reasons that might lead to a crime of this nature. Understanding the motive can help focus the investigation and ensure that all available leads are followed.
